Making dishes with the letter “W” could be seen as a real challenge, but Chef Lauren Gulyas has got it covered. Choosing water chestnut and watercress as her star ingredients, Chef Lauren begins by serving up an Asian inspired rice dish complete with crunchy water chestnuts. She starts off cooking rice in chicken broth, a great way to infuse the grain with a subtle savoury flavour. Sautéing celery, garlic, and onion in sesame oil adds a flavour kick. Throw in some ginger, veggies, and water chestnuts and enjoy the sound of the sizzle. Next up, Lauren puts a peppery twist on a classic recipe, linguine with watercress pesto. Then it's time for the grand finale, Chef Lauren uses both ingredients to create the ultimate culinary combination.

Co-hosts Jasmin Ibrahim and Shahir Massoud get to the "root" of spicing up your food as they cook dishes using spice roots! First up, they prepare a creamy Carrot and Galangal Soup, however they don't use cream, opting for cashews instead! Next up, a frosty, golden Turmeric Semifreddo, studded with jewel-like apricots and pistachios! Last but not least is a steaming bowl of mussels, spiced with not one, not two, but three kinds of ginger! How can you not 'root' for these dishes?

A tasty four-course Vietnamese meal using fruit? Yes, please! For her first dish, talented home cook Lisa Nguyen uses tangy tamarind pulp to balance flavours in a savoury bowl of Vietnamese Sour Fish Soup. Then, she combines tart pomelo and sweet pineapple with juicy crab meat for a flavourful salad. Next up, hot Chicken Coconut Curry with a hint of citrusy lemongrass, sweet potatoes, and a kaffir lime leaf. Pair it with a warm, toasty baguette and you're good to go! Lisa's last dish is a mouth-watering, classic Vietnamese dessert. Soft and chewy Steamed Banana Cake drizzled in a sweet velvety coconut sauce crunchy sesame seeds will have you begging for more!
